Miniature of the construction of Solomon's Temple. In the foreground workmen are depicted mixing mortar, fetching water, making a mortise-joint in the surface of one of the block of stone and carving mouldings on others. The completed work is gilded whilst the upper portion is still white. Created by Jean Fouquet, a preeminent French painter of the 15th century. Dated 15th Century
